Hawksmoor.
Booked almost two months in advance for my partner, the night had finally come where I got to indulge in what had been tipped the best steak in London.
My partner and I headed down the dimly lit Langley street in London's Soho area and were confronted with large wooden doors, as if we were entering a castle, after entering the venue we were lead down a dramatic staircase and into the bar area to begin the festivities with some cocktails.
An extensive cocktail list was presented to us, categorized to allow for all day drinking. There were the
Solid Straight cocktails that were best drunk at 6pm, whilst the
Sparkler cocktails were enjoyed post meat intake with perhaps cheese and crackers. The one that seemed to float into my vision was the
Grapefruit Picador, this sultry drink combined Tequila
, Velvet Falernum, Lime Juice, Grapefruit Sherbet and proved to be a worthy candidate for my palate.
Not long after we finished we headed over to our table. The cocktail area, although dimly lit and with fewer seats, did prove an intimate setting to begin the valentines day evening. The main dining hall was more abuzz with many conversations flowing. You would be stumped to know if there was music playing or not amongst all that banter.
We, funnily enough, had a charming Australian waiter who assisted us with our wine selection to accompany our
Chatudebriand. Sound fancy? This is a recipe from a particular thick cut of tenderloin, often one that the French carve very well.
Our steak selection (950 grams) served us well, as did our sides,
Triple Cooked Chips - how chips can be super crunchy, yet fluffy on the inside and still maintain their golden colour, is beyond my thought process. Along with the potatoes from heaven, we orderd some
Creamed Spinach, so flavoursome I could have devoured the entire lot.
Our
Chatubriand was to die for, succulent, juicy, tender and oh so tasty, this was definitely one of my favourite steak experiences to date. My partner was blown away and declared it to be the best steak he had ever eaten. Teamed with a stilton sauce, poured at our discretion, it was safe to say we were in tastebud ecstasy.
We didn't seem to stop there, with my sweet-tooth analyzing the dessert menu. The
Peanut Butter Shortbread won me over and on presentation was a mouthwatering delight.
Hawksmoor is quite an experience. It takes core staples: meat, cheese, potatoes and spinach and creates a perfectly palate pleasing combination, where every element has been thought through in great detail. The meat, spinach, a chip combined on my fork was a flavour like no other I had experienced, I can't even describe it to you. Do yourself a favor, just get on the phone and book yourself in ASAP.
